    BSc Programs in Energy Studies

    A bachelor’s degree, or BSc, is awarded to students who complete a three to five year course of study. This degree may be the first step on the path to more educational opportunities or it may be the door to a rewarding career in the student’s chosen field.

    What is a BSc in energy studies? There are many different areas of focus in this discipline from which to choose. These include wildlife conservation, petroleum engineering, environment and energy, and sustainable agriculture, just to name a few. Classes might cover subjects such as global and regional energy systems, industrial energy systems, and the energy systems of buildings. Students learn about the relationships between energy, the environment, and the economy.

    In a world where more and more people rely on energy to enjoy a certain standard of life, there is a great need for individuals who have a good grasp of the principles that make that energy readily available. Graduates can expect to find a variety of career options in many areas of the world.

    The cost of participation in a BSC in energy program can vary widely between schools, particularly as schools are located in many different countries of the world. In order to get accurate information about prices, prospective students should talk directly to the schools of their choice.

    After completing the program, graduates enjoy several diverse job opportunities. They are prepared to make critical judgments and to work independently, and are able to apply problem-solving skills to real-life energy problems. Graduates typically find employment with professionals who work in the environmental management sector or as engineers for petroleum companies. They might find careers as researchers who aim to improve crops and to increase sustainable farming.

    Admission to this program often requires a good grasp of mathematics and the sciences.
